Outdoor Applications for Epoxy Floor Resin Products

Creating a resilient, attractive outdoor surface with epoxy floor resin is possible with the right selection and preparation. Not every epoxy is made for exposure to sunlight and weather—choosing specialised products is key for patios, driveways, and open walkways.

Choosing the Right Epoxy Resin for Outdoor Spaces

For external projects, select resins specifically engineered to withstand outdoor challenges.   • Check the resin labelling for UV and weather resistance.
  • Ensure compatibility with your substrate, especially for concrete, stone, or cement.

Preparation and Application Tips

Outdoor resin flooring demands careful groundwork. Surfaces must be dry, clean, and stable. Remove dust, old coatings, and moisture before primer or resin application. Always follow manufacturer instructions for mixing and curing, paying attention to temperature and outdoor conditions.

  • Avoid applying resin in damp, frosty, or very hot weather.
  • Allow full curing time—outdoor areas may require longer due to temperature fluctuations.

When Outdoor-Grade Resin Really Matters

Using a non-weatherproof resin outside can lead to rapid loss of colour, yellowing, or cracking. Outdoor-grade products, like those mentioned above, are necessary for areas constantly exposed to light and weather—saving you time and repairs in the long-term.
